What is the difference between Leasing Direct vs Leasing Agent?

AspectLeasing DirectLeasing Agent
CredentialsHigh school diploma; real estate license often preferredHigh school diploma; real estate license often required
Work EnvironmentCorporate office, on-site leasing centersOn-site at properties, leasing offices, or remotely
Employer & IndustryProperty management companies, real estate firmsProperty management companies, leasing agencies
Primary ResponsibilitiesHandle leasing inquiries, process applications, coordinate with prospectsShow properties, assist clients, process lease agreements

Leasing Direct typically focuses on handling leasing processes directly for property management companies, often working in a corporate setting. Leasing Agents usually engage directly with prospective tenants, showing properties and assisting with lease signing. Both roles require similar credentials but differ mainly in their daily tasks and work environment.

Job description

The Leasing Director drives, oversees, and delegates to achieve leasing and renewal goals, occupancy goals, available product, pricing goals, trends, and recommendations, trending and reporting and the development, monitoring and implementation of all marketing promotions and programs. This position is also responsible for being the most productive leaser as the role model for the leasing team, leading the leasing at properties that have challenges, developing new and changing current training programs and procedures, mentoring and overseeing the leasing team and partnering with the manager or multi-site manager, leads weekly management meetings. Operates as an independent leasing and marketing professional.

  • Motivates a team of leasing consultants to meet goals, ensure occupancy and exceptional customer service.
  • Lead and implement resident retention programs.
  • Reviews weekly property occupancy reports and obtains information on current marketing efforts in order to update and make recommendations to the PM in weekly meetings.
  • Develops and implements marketing promotions and programs with emphasis on corporate outreach and preferred employer programs.
  • Develops, publishes and implements a training schedule for programs including marketing and sales training, product knowledge, skills, attitudes, policies, and procedures, computer, etc. The schedule should include training for newly hired leasing consultants as well as existing ones.
  • Shops and surveys competition to assess their marketing program, i.e. incentives, give-a-ways, reductions, curb appeal, rental efforts and efficiency, etc.
  • Completes full market study for property including rent comparisons, unit mix, amenity features, services, etc. Drafts marketing plan including timetable for marketing/management actions including logo design, complete collateral package, professional/designer selection, lease-up schedule, training staff, establishing preferred employer programs, corporate suites, grand opening, etc., as applicable.
  • Responsible for performing marketing study for property including analysis of any marketing opportunities, target markets, evaluation of leasing personnel, rental levels, critiques of signage, advertising, curb appeal, competition, training needs, etc.
  • Works in designing and writing project display ads and reviews all advertising media to ensure effectiveness and compliance with Fair Housing.
  • Attends marketing and training seminars presented by such organizations as the Apartment Association to ensure that property marketing and training remains current.
  • Assign, review and oversee all daily leasing paperwork.
  • Audit and adhere to lease file policy with consistency.
  • Responsible for implementing lease renewal and resident retention programs.
  • Advocate for corporate led Marketing performance contest.
  • Assist with resident relations, which includes taking resident phone calls, requests and concerns.
  • Analyze weekly leasing and pricing reports and forecast occupancy trends.
  • Manage and track marketing strategies, including advertising, promotions and publications. Regularly review all online and published advertising sources for accuracy and effectiveness.
  • Conduct property and unit walks to ensure that units and tour path always represent our standards.
  • Review aged vacancies, market-ready apartments and models.
  • Manage, train and coach onsite leasing staff effectively. Conducts weekly one on one meetings with leasing staff recommending, planning, and track training, development and growth opportunities. Obtains bids and recommends novelty items such as coffee mugs, water bottles, key chains, etc. featuring property/company logo.
  • Regularly reviews satisfaction survey results and makes recommendation of improvement.
  • Evaluates market for trends in traffic, specials and pricing to make weekly market and pricing recommendations directly to Property Manager.
  • Prepares for, participates and may conduct weekly pricing evaluation.
  • Responsible for developing new and changing current training procedures.
  • Creates and ensures move-in orientation process is consistently completed for every move in.
  • Conducts apartment and general property tours, takes telephone inquiries, greets future residents, takes applications and deposits while verifying information, and follow-up of all future residents.
  • Ensures the office, business center, clubhouse, models, target apartments and market ready apartments are in perfect condition. Physically inspect property when on grounds, pick up litter and report any service needs to maintenance staff.  Inspect move-outs and vacancies.
